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:
To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, how much funding was allocated to each clinical commissioning group area in London per head of population in 2017-18; what funding is proposed to be so allocated in 2018-19; and if he will make a statement.
NHS England publishes allocations for each clinical commissioning group (CCG) on its website. Per capita allocations for core CCG services for London CCGs in 2017-18 are listed on page 12, column 19 of the document that can be found here:
https://www.england.nhs.uk/wp-content/uploads/2016/01/ccg-allocations.pdf
It should be noted that the figures for 2017/18 do not include any adjustments that may have been agreed since the time of publication.
Revised allocations for core CCG services for 2018-19 were published in February 2018, and are accessible via the link below. Per capita allocations for London CCGs can be found on page 3, column 11.
